Symptoms
We are aware of a known issue on devices with Intel Trusted Execution Technology (TXT) enabled on 10th generation or later Intel vPro processors. On these systems, installing the May 13, 2025, Windows security update (KB5058379) might cause lsass.exe to terminate unexpectedly, triggering an Automatic Repair. On devices with BitLocker enabled, BitLocker requires the input of your BitLocker recovery key to initiate the Automatic Repair.
Affected devices then enter one of two states:
Some devices might make several attempts to install update KB5058379 before Startup Repair successfully rolls back to the previously installed update.
Startup Repair might experience a failure that creates a reboot loop, which again initiates an Automatic Repair, returning the device to the BitLocker recovery screen.
Consumer devices typically do not use Intel vPro processors and are less likely to be impacted by this issue.
Resolution
This issue was resolved by Windows updates released May 19, 2025 (KB5061768), and later. We recommend you install the latest update for your device as it contains important improvements and issue resolutions, including this one.
